There are plenty of muscle car fans out there, but many of us simply can’t afford to buy one or have the time to restore one of the classics. This holds true for Greg, his dream muscle car to own is the 1969 Chevrolet Camaro Z/28, but getting one into his garage isn’t so simple. So when the opportunity popped up to review the Kyosho 1969 Chevy Camaro Z/28 Fazer Mk2 FZ-02L ready to run 1/10 electric on-road RC car, he jumped right on it. Kyosho has done another amazing job adding the licensed Chevy Camro to their line of ultra scale on-road cars. The detail and styling of the body is absolutely stunning. But it doesn’t end there, they mounted the body to their well designed 4wd Fazer FZ-02L chassis which is pretty impressive for a basher style set-up. Rounding out the package is some worthy electronics that are sure to bump up the fun factor of driving this RC muscle car. Get all the details you need in our full review!

I bought the GTO as well and ,,,I,,,I...(speechless). The GTO is bigger and just as beautiful. Just FYI...the Camaro is a standard 260mm wheelbase so any 1/10 on-road body should fit. The GTO is bigger...with a wheelbase of 275mm...so finding a different body for the Pontiac could be difficult.
